Transaction eac944384e28216429c4048b21fdce681deb86a26331f4f76598d753c58168fd
1 Input
1 Output
-
eac944384e28216429c4048b21fdce681deb86a26331f4f76598d753c58168fd:0
- value
- 94715
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 31534c17a2b6a9a05587c2151ce94afd0b73a981 OP_EQUAL
- address
- 36BppY6BindatsswfTSrJ5wGik42RqQ7Ec